Chapter 343 Neutrality is Not Easy
Xu Ke told his family that he had to go on a business trip.
The family, including Mowen, didn't think much of it.
Before leaving Beijing, he met with the team leader, surnamed Chen.
Team leader Chen briefly explained to him the things he needed to prepare before leaving.
So he went home to prepare, instructing everyone to keep things as simple as possible.
But he, putting everything else aside, just his clothes alone—a single set would consist of several pieces, plus corresponding accessories. Even though he only had the maid pack a few changes of clothes and a light and heavy cloak, plus underwear and two pairs of shoes, it already filled three large trunks on the floor…
Xu Ke shook his head upon seeing this. "I'm going on horseback, how can I carry three suitcases? Besides, we're going to a remote and impoverished area, and these clothes won't fit. Just find two sets of clothes that are comfortable for the road and won't get dirty easily. If all else fails, we can buy more along the way."
The next day, he brought a servant boy with him, each carrying a bundle, the servant boy's bundle being particularly large!
Five miles outside the city, when we met up with our companions...
He felt that even though he was wearing the simplest clothes and using the simplest things, compared to his companions, he still looked like a young master going out for a stroll.
His face turned red.
Team Leader Chen smiled and said, "Young Master Xu has never experienced this before, so he'll have to suffer a bit if he turns back."
"Just call me Xu Ke, team leader." Xu Ke looked into the distance and said, "People always have to endure hardship."
It's not this kind of suffering, it's more like...
Without saying much, he cracked his whip. The dozen or so men, leaving a trail of dust, quickly disappeared into the distance.
Princess Yu'an didn't understand what had happened; she had argued with the Crown Prince and didn't want to ask him anymore...
They wanted to get information from the Xu family.
However, Princess Yu'an still had some reservations about the Xu family. Although she wanted to go and beat them up when she was angry, she only "wanted" and did not dare to actually do so.
They sent their men to inquire, and after spending some money, they actually found out from the kitchen staff who delivered and collected the vegetables: "Our Third Master is away on official business."
On official business?
He's already resigned from his official post, so what official duties could he possibly have left?
Princess Yu'an had nothing to do at home, so she kept thinking about this.
Checking the posts received by the Princess's residence, she found a banquet that the Xu family might attend, so she went there and actually ran into Xu Ke's sister-in-law.
She found an opportunity to chat with the young mistress of the Xu family. Then, Princess Yu'an said, seemingly casually, "I heard from my brother, the Crown Prince, that the third young master of the Xu family has resigned from his official post... I wonder where he has taken up a new position?"
Madam Xu was taken aback upon hearing this, but then smiled and said, "I'm not afraid of the princess laughing at me, but I had no idea what my third uncle was doing before. As for what the princess is talking about, I have even less to say."
Judging from his expression, he really didn't know.
They stopped asking and just then someone came over to pay their respects to Princess Yu'an.
Madam Xu bowed and withdrew, but she was puzzled: Wasn't Xu Ke on official business? Why did he resign?
Besides, what does it matter to Princess Guan Yu'an whether he resigns from his official post or not? It seems like she's asking on purpose!
She is, after all, the eldest daughter-in-law of the Xu family; she's not someone to be trifled with.
After returning home from a round of social engagements, I hurriedly went to find my mother-in-law and told her about it.
Madam Xu was even more surprised, but she calmly said, "We don't know what happened yet, so let's not talk about it."
He turned around and went to call the servants who were attending to Xu Ke.
A short while later, a servant came and handed her a letter. "Madam, this is from the Third Master. He asked me to give you the letter in a few days."
Madam Xu quickly took it and opened it to read.
Xu Kexin's meaning is: He's involved in something he can't resolve on his own. He needs to go out and avoid trouble for a while. Fortunately, a benefactor has given him an opportunity, and he's determined to make amends for his past mistakes.
This journey is fraught with uncertainty, its outcome uncertain, and its return date undetermined.
Unable to explain the situation to his grandfather and father, he hoped his mother could help him negotiate.
Furthermore, I hope that Mother can take care of Mowen and not let him go out before he writes to me or returns.
I'll be careful in everything, but I can't guarantee nothing will happen. I hope my mother has some peace of mind...
After reading it, Madam Xu's eyes narrowed slightly, her heart pounding. He hadn't even said anything to reassure her...
This is no small matter!
Her mind raced, replaying everything that had happened to Xu Ke: first, he was unwilling to get married; later, under pressure from his family, he said he had his eye on Mo Wen. But once they were engaged, he seemed indifferent. On their wedding night, he coldly treated his bride…
At the time, I also suspected that something was going on here; he was either gay or had someone he couldn't have feelings for...
Instead of following his family's connections or taking the imperial examinations, he sought employment on his own.
He found a job on his own... and I didn't even think much of it?
Then everything went smoothly, and they even got involved in the grand martial arts competition hosted by the Crown Prince. Next, Mo Wen became pregnant, and yes, he was injured. Until the miscarriage…
Now they say I've made a mistake and need to stay away. But they won't let me tell my grandfather and father.
Princess Yu'an even took the initiative to talk to the eldest son's wife about this matter.
So that's how it is...
She sat there, her body trembling slightly, her eyes a little moist.
How could he be so foolish?!
In an instant, my mind was flooded with people and events, making my head throb.
How long have they been together? Suddenly, another shock: Princess Yu'an has divorced! Is she... planning to marry Xu Ke?
Madam Xu felt nauseous... No wonder Xu Ke wanted to run away.
She quickly folded the letter; she couldn't let her father-in-law and husband know! And her mother-in-law too…
Thinking of the two elderly people, who lived a life of integrity and could talk about anything without reservation, it's heartbreaking to see them suffer such a fate in their old age.
She could already imagine what would happen to Xu Ke—either he'd be kicked out of the house, or he'd be beaten half to death and forced to become a monk… But even so, her father-in-law and husband couldn't bear the shame.
She clutched the letter tightly in her hand.
So where did he go? "A benefactor gave him an opportunity"?
A while ago, he stayed at home all day and didn't go anywhere... except for a trip to the Mo family!
That is: He met His Highness Prince Qi at the Mohist school; the "noble person" refers to Prince Qi! He went to work for Prince Qi...
Now I understand completely.
But if that's the case, I can't keep it a secret from my father-in-law and husband!
In the evening, the men of the Xu family returned and gathered in the front study to talk.
Lord Xu's official rank wasn't particularly high, but the things he did were quite important. What's even more remarkable is that there were no useless members in the Xu family. The children in the family were all diligent and ambitious, all of them taking the imperial examination route and then entering officialdom; not one of them was incompetent.
Looking across the world, they are undoubtedly a distinguished and noble family.
The Emperor was very accommodating!
When the maid went in to report the time, the men were somewhat surprised. What was it that they couldn't wait and rushed to the front to tell them?
Madam Xu went in and said, "Father, I have something I'd like to tell you."
The old man waved his hand, and everyone else went back to their rooms, leaving only her husband behind.
Old Master Xu said, "Please sit down."
Madam Xu sat down, her hands clenched together. How could she possibly bring herself to say those words?
Seeing her nervousness, the father and son exchanged a glance and said, "Go ahead and speak."
“Father, there’s something I’m just speculating about, and it’s not certain. I shouldn’t say it like this. But if it’s true, I might make things worse if I don’t tell you.”
This daughter-in-law has always been steady and knows when to advance and retreat. What's wrong with her today?
Old Master Xu thought to himself, "There are no outsiders here, so I'm not afraid of saying the wrong thing."
"Yes." Madam Xu glanced at her husband. "Father, Xu Ke may have done something not so good..."
The father and son frowned.
“He wasn’t on official business, but rather…” She felt she couldn’t quite put her finger on it.
So he took out the letter, and Old Master Xu took it to read it. After reading it, he handed it to his son.
"This is all so unclear, do you know what's going on?"
“Before, your daughter-in-law didn’t know either. Now I have a guess, but I really can’t say it. I’m afraid that if it’s not true, it will tarnish my son’s reputation for no reason. Why don’t we skip this and go straight to the point: Xu Ke did something wrong and he regrets it. His Highness Prince Qi should also know about this. Your daughter-in-law thinks that Xu Ke asked His Highness for help. His Highness asked him to go out and do something, and to stay away for now.”
The father and son's expressions turned serious.
“My wife knows that the Xu family is loyal to the emperor and diligent in their duties, never getting involved in anything outside the established order. Even though they became entangled with the Prince Qi's mansion because of the ink pattern, it didn't affect the Xu family's uprightness. But Xu Ke first dragged the Xu family into the Crown Prince's camp, and now they are under the protection of the Prince Qi…”
At this point, Madam Xu realized she had misspoke.
The father and son exchanged another glance... still not understanding!
Lord Xu scoffed: "The Xu family has a deep foundation, so it's perfectly normal for people to try and win them over. If it were the eldest son, it might be somewhat effective, since he'll be the future head of the family. But trying to win over Xu Ke... Don't be fooled by his smooth career; what he does has nothing to do with the Xu family's foundation. What good would it do? Whose orders can he make? And what use are his promises?"
Lord Xu nodded, "That's true."
But looking at her daughter-in-law's awkward manner, it wasn't quite like that.
Lord Xu was annoyed: "As long as we don't involve him in... cough cough, everything will be fine. If you have something to say, just say it. Whether it's right or wrong, we can be prepared. We can't let them catch us off guard when things come to a head!"
Madam Xu gave a bitter smile...
